Transaction ab0f26b60f3143c34330e18aa4f7b4ee4e27ef9ed1f393a2085357e217a113b4

1 Input
2 Outputs
  • ab0f26b60f3143c34330e18aa4f7b4ee4e27ef9ed1f393a2085357e217a113b4:0
  • value  11357397
    address  3Fn6zDG8DsengKuDwTbcjwUY1FsB3zGdjs
  • ab0f26b60f3143c34330e18aa4f7b4ee4e27ef9ed1f393a2085357e217a113b4:1
  • value  1403053
    address  3QEtfAyYzMq59zRfYtavpzgiGWUJoFje9r